The introduction of HTTPS, which layers HTTP over SSL/TLS encryption, has become the standard, securing data in transit and building user trust. The Critical Role of Headers Headers are key-value pairs sent with both requests and responses that provide crucial context and metadata.
Understanding HTTP Status Codes: 200, 404, and 500 Explained
The Foundation of Client-Server Communication The interaction model is straightforward: a client, typically a web browser, initiates a request to access a resource on a server. This simplicity is by design, allowing for scalability and ease of implementation across a vast array of devices and networks.
A 404 status code warns that the server cannot find the requested resource, while a 500 status code reveals an internal server error that prevented the request from being completed. Properly configured headers are vital for security, performance, and ensuring the browser renders content correctly.
Understanding HTTP Status Codes Like 200, 404, and 500
Status Codes: The Language of Responses Servers communicate the outcome of a request using status codes, which are three-digit numbers grouped into classes. PUT: Uploads a representation of the specified resource, often used to update existing data.
More About Http protocol basics
Looking at Http protocol basics from another angle can help expand the discussion and give readers a second clear paragraph under the same section.
More perspective on Http protocol basics can make the topic easier to follow by connecting earlier points with a few simple takeaways.